Generated Narrative: CodeSystem extension-style

This case-sensitive code system http://hl7.org/fhir/tools/CodeSystem/extension-style defines the following codes:

CodeDefinition
none No extensions
fhir-extensions FHIR extension style: the element defines 'extension' which can be constrained by profiles
named-elements The type can be extended by having additional named elements, where the name is from the elementdefinition-xml-name or elementdefinition-json-name for xml and json respectively
